    摘要:

    以共沉淀法和貴金屬修飾技術,研制了一種新型的稀土基復合催化材料作為車用三效催化劑的催化涂層。通過發(fā)動機臺架測試技術評價該催化劑的催化活性,并按嚴格的歐Ⅳ排放法規(guī),通過整車轉鼓試驗和實車道路試驗,評價該催化劑對排放廢氣的處理能力和耐久性。結果表明,以該催化材料制備的催化劑不僅具有十分優(yōu)異的起燃特性、空燃比特性和廢氣處理能力,而且劣化程度低、抗老化能力強,完全可以配合所匹配車型達到歐Ⅳ排放標準的限值要求和耐久性要求。

    Abstract:

    A new rare-earth-based catalytic material with low loading precious metals, used for catalytic coating of the three-way catalysts was prepared by co-precipitation method and precious metals modifier technology. The catalyst activities were evaluated by engine-bench test technology; their purify capabilities for vehicle exhaust and durability were evaluated by rotary drum test and vehicle road test according to the critical Europe IV emission rule. The results demonstrate that the catalysts prepared by the catalytic material have not only excellent light-off characteristic, air-fuel ratio characteristic, and high purify capability for the vehicle exhaust but also low degradation coefficient and high anti-aging performance, which ensure the vehicle emission level and durability meeting the Europe IV standard requirement for the matching vehicle entirely.
